Gilded
Serpent welcomes submission of materials
concerning all forms of Middle Eastern music and dance
from all the facets of our colorful and diverse community!
By submitting your materials to Gilded Serpent you are accepting
the following standards:
1) Submit your unpublished
articles only! Articles that appear subsequently in other
magazines will be retired to our archives or removed at our
discretion. On
occasion, GS may republished material that is no longer available
elsewhere as a service to the music and dance community.
We do not publish articles that are already available
on your own (or any other) site! Your article will
remain on our site as long as GS exists
because it is our intent is to make it readily
available to the public through our archives.
It may be more prestigious for you to link from your site to the
page where GS has presented your work on this highly visible media
site. If for any reason your article is republished
elsewhere, Gilded Serpent must be notified and credited: "Previously
published on GildedSerpent.com on mo/dy/yr (and linked if on a
website)."
If your article appears in a printed source, please send a copy
of that issue to our offices at P.O. Box 1928, San Anselmo, CA
94979.
2) Articles and reviews
must be entertaining even while educating or discussing a serious
subject. Keep your point in focus. Please submit only your final
draft for proofing and editing.
3)Length
of submissions should be no longer than approximately 3 pages.
GS may present longer articles in more than one installment.
All articles remain accessible in our archives permanently.
4) Limit self-serving plugs.
Use your "Bio Page" (see below) to promote yourself,
your event, or your website and not the article itself. If you
must mention an event in your article,
it must relate to the subject of the article. Just make a simple
statement. GS will provide a link to your site on your own bio
page
with your submission.
